I am so grateful to be able to run the Toronto Waterfront Half Marathon to raise money for Cystic Fibrosis Canada. 16 years ago I lost a dear friend to CF, and I run a race every year in honour of him. Since the early 2000s the advancements in medications and treatments have changed the average lifespan of someone with CF from 17-30 years into 60 years. Those living with Cystic Fibrosis now have access to better management of chronic lung diseases, better medications to combat infections and further access to gene-modifying medications.

I am excited to participate in the 2025 TCS Toronto Waterfront Marathon with Team CF Canada! Cystic Fibrosis (CF) is the most common fatal genetic disease affecting Canadian children and young adults. At present, there is no cure.
